Anti-populist coups d’état in the twenty-first century: reasons, dynamics and consequences

Abstract

There is a burgeoning literature on how to deal with populism in advanced liberal democracies, which puts a strong emphasis on legalist and pluralist methods. There is also a new and expanding literature that looks at the consequences of coups d’état for democracies by employing large-N data sets. These two recent literatures, however, do not speak to one another, based on the underlying assumption that coups against populists were a distinctly twentieth-century Latin American phenomenon. Yet the cases of Venezuela in 2002, Thailand in 2006 and Turkey in 2016 show that anti-populist coups have also occurred in the twenty-first century. Focussing on these cases, the article enquires about the extent to which military coups succeed against populists. The main finding is that although anti-populist coups may initially take over the government, populism survives in the long run. Thus, anti-populist coups fail in their own terms and they do not succeed in eradicating populism. In fact, in the aftermath of a coup, populism gains further legitimacy against what it calls repressive elites, while possibilities for democratisation are further eroded. This is because populists tap into existing socio-cultural divides and politically mobilise the hitherto underrepresented sectors in their societies that endure military interventions.

二十一世纪的反民粹政变:原因,动力和后果

摘要

关于如何处理先进的自由民主国家中的民粹主义的新兴文献,特别强调了法制和多元主义方法。也有新的和不断扩展的文献,它通过使用大量N数据集来探讨政变对民主国家的后果。然而,这两项最新文献并未相互对话,其基础假设是针对民粹主义者的政变是二十世纪的拉丁美洲现象。然而,2002年的委内瑞拉,2006年的泰国和2016年的土耳其的案例表明,在二十一世纪也发生了反民粹政变。着眼于这些案件,文章询问军事政变在多大程度上成功打击了民粹主义者。主要发现是,尽管反民粹政变最初可能接管政府,从长远来看,民粹主义得以生存。因此,反民粹政变就其自身而言是失败的,并且它们在消除民粹主义方面没有成功。实际上,在政变之后,民粹主义获得了对其所谓的压制精英的进一步合法性,同时民主化的可能性进一步受到侵蚀。这是因为民粹主义者利用了现有的社会文化鸿沟,并在政治上动员了其本来可以忍受军事干预的社会中代表性不足的部门。
